Software Engineer (Java) - Trading Systems Job at Executive Placement Network, New York, NY

TVlxc1JPaG91Y0xPcUNCbXdicFhFZ1BTZkE9PQ==
  • Executive Placement Network
  • New York, NY

Job Description

Software Engineer (Java) - Trading Systems

We are seeking a highly skilled Software Engineer (Java) to join a top-tier financial technology firm specializing in low-latency trading systems . This role offers the opportunity to design, develop, and maintain front-to-back trading infrastructure , working across order management, exchange connectivity, smart order routing, internalization, and clearing systems .

📍 Location: New York, NY ( Onsite Required )

Key Responsibilities

  • Design, develop, and maintain proprietary low-latency trading systems and infrastructure.
  • Build high-performance trading tools that enhance execution efficiency and system reliability.
  • Optimize the scalability, performance, and efficiency of the trading platform.
  • Develop distributed and scalable systems to meet future business and technical demands.
  • Handle a diverse set of projects , from frontend trading tools to backend infrastructure in multiple programming languages.
  • Collaborate closely with traders, quants, and other engineers to implement best-in-class solutions.

Required Qualifications

B.S. or M.S. in Computer Science, Computer Engineering, or related field (or equivalent experience).
5+ years of experience designing and building distributed and scalable software in Java, Go, or C++ .
✔ Strong understanding of low-latency, high-performance systems .
✔ Experience in high-throughput environments , working with real-time data and large-scale distributed systems .
✔ Self-driven personality with the ability to take initiative and lead technical projects.
✔ Excellent written and verbal communication skills to collaborate across teams.

Preferred Qualifications

⭐ Experience in Python .
⭐ Hands-on experience in distributed systems and highly concurrent architectures .
⭐ Familiarity with Fixed Income Credit & Rates trading systems .
⭐ Deep understanding of low-latency trading systems and exchange connectivity .
⭐ Experience working with relational databases for high-frequency trading applications.

Key Skills Matrix

Category Skill Importance Experience Level
Programming Java, Go, or C++🔥 10/10 Advanced
Trading Systems Order Management, Exchange Connectivity 🔥 9/10 Advanced
Performance Optimization Low-Latency & High-Performance Computing 🔥 9/10 Advanced
Distributed Systems Designing & Scaling Large Systems 🔥 8/10 Proficient
Backend & Infrastructure Building High-Throughput, Scalable Solutions 🔥 8/10 Proficient
Collaboration & Communication Working with Traders, Quants & Engineers 🔥 8/10 Proficient

This is a high-impact role where you will be at the core of trading technology innovation .

🔹 Interested in applying? View more job openings here: EPN Job Board

About EPN

EPN is a leading recruitment agency specializing in technology, trading, and quantitative finance roles for top-tier firms. We connect highly skilled professionals with high-profile opportunities , ensuring the best fit for both candidates and employers.

Job Tags

Similar Jobs

MAU Workforce Solutions

Maintenance Technician Job at MAU Workforce Solutions

MAU is hiring a Maintenance Technician for Quoizel Lighting in Goose Creek, SC. As a Maintenance Technician, you will be responsible for performing preventative maintenance, repairs, and upkeep of the facility and equipment. This is a direct-hire opportunity.Benefits... 

DEPT OF HEALTH/MENTAL HYGIENE

Public Health Inspector, Bureau of Food Safety and Community Sanitation (BFSCS) Job at DEPT OF HEALTH/MENTAL HYGIENE

Public Health Inspector, Bureau of Food Safety and Community Sanitation (BFSCS) Location New York, NY : DEPT OF HEALTH/MENTAL HYGIENE...  ...Posted until 05/08/2026~ Experience Level: Experienced (Non-Manager) Job level 01 Number of positions 1 Work location NYC -... 

Paramount

Rigger Job at Paramount

 ...visionary artists and storytellers together to form a world-class animation studio.**Responsibilities**+ Must be able to create fast rigs, minimum @ 24FPS real time playback in Maya with five keyed characters for both body and face+ Develop a rigging system to rig... 

ClearFocus Technologies

Senior Cybersecurity Analyst/Information Security Manager Job at ClearFocus Technologies

 ...paid time off,401(k),paid professionaldevelopment reimbursementand more!We are seeking aSenior Cybersecurity Analyst/Information Security Manager for an opportunity in Washington, DC. All applicants must have an active Top-Secret clearance and SCI/Q-eligibility.... 

Westwood Village

Director of Celebrations (Activities) and Transportation- Sun.-Thurs. Job at Westwood Village

 ...motivates residents regarding appropriate individual and group activities based on resident interests and opportunities for growth....  ...organizes a calendar of events. Submits the calendar to the Executive Director for final approval. Posts and distributes the calendar....